WebOct 18, 2024 · futhermore, when i run fp16 inference by calling model.half(), the memory is not reduced either. If you are checking the used memory via nvidia-smi, note that you might see the cached memory as well. torch.cuda.memory_allocated() … WebMay 26, 2024 · At least five floating-point arithmetics are available in mainstream hardware: the IEEE double precision (fp64), single precision (fp32), and half precision (fp16) formats, bfloat16, and tf32, introduced in the recently announced NVIDIA A100, which uses the NVIDIA Ampere GPU architecture. Only fp32 and fp64 are available on current Intel …
Pytorch model FP32 to FP16 using half()- LSTM block is not casted
Web18 hours ago · The text was updated successfully, but these errors were encountered: WebMay 8, 2024 · fp16 SVD Calculator Thanks Background The IEEE 754 standard, published in 1985, defines formats for floating point numbers that occupy 32 or 64 bits of storage. These formats are known as binary32 … html button for email
Half The Precision, Twice The Fun: Working With FP16 In HLSL
WebJan 23, 2024 · In recent years, the big bang for machine learning and deep learning has focused significant attention on half-precision (FP16). Using reduced precision levels … WebJan 28, 2024 · Half-precision, or FP16, on the other hand, reserves one bit for the sign, 5 bits for the exponent (-14 to +14) and 10 for the digits. Comparison of the format for FP16 (top) and FP32 (bottom) floating-point numbers. The number shown, for illustrative purposes, is the largest number less than one that can be represented by each format ... WebSep 27, 2024 · What you're referring to as "half" is a colloquial term for the IEEE-754:2008 Binary16 type (otherwise known as FP16) which is codified as a new addition into both the C and C++ 23 specifications. Because of the nature of C++, you will be able to access the type via its C naming convention of _Float16, or its C++ naming convention of std::float16_t hocking county recorder